Regional Account Director, Northwest
Regional Account Director, Northwest will be responsible for managing all aspects of targeted/assigned regional accounts to include all channel and vertical segments. This person will work directly with argenx XFT partners (Market Access, FRMs, Sales, Marketing, Medical, Legal) as the single point of contact responsible for argenx portfolio of products. The primary responsibility of the role is to ensure appropriate access to argenx portfolio of products and optimize access with minimal barriers. The right candidate will possess a broad and deep network of established relationships with key stakeholders within assigned accounts to execute the argenx Access strategy. They will also be responsible for developing, and executing account business plans that deliver on the described requirements. This is a field-based role reporting to the Head of US Regional Access.
Roles And Responsibilities The ideal candidate will interact with other personnel within the US Market Access team and ultimately be responsible for the implementation of account specific strategies designed to ensure appropriate access. Additionally, the role will be responsible for providing critical, timely, account level competitive intelligence concerning assigned regional payers, home infusion service providers and Specialty Pharmacy partners to stakeholders within the argenx organization. Role will provide insights and recommendations to argenx Market Access Team and assist in the development of strategic plans for argenx portfolio products. Other responsibilities include:- Identify, develop and execute business opportunities by focusing on appropriate positioning and messaging of argenx products within targeted customer segments
- Identify, resolve and communicate appropriate action or process to gain product access for patients
- Provide insights and interpretation of Medicare Part B/D and commercial payer coverage policies which may impact access to argenx products
- Educate and collaborate with internal stakeholders and other key XFT stakeholders on targeted payer coverage policies for argenx products
- Proactively identify potential marketplace trends/barriers within targeted accounts as well as overall payer landscape and respond to any identified reimbursement, coverage issues and market access challenges
- Strategically deploy resources (individual skills and company resources) throughout the lifecycle of the account relationship to maximum impact within the account
- Analyze and understand payer environment, key account business dynamics and priorities, in creating account plan that aligns to argenx business objectives.
- Develop and grow business partnerships and relationships with key stakeholders within assigned accounts (CEO, CFE, CMO, Director of Pharmacy, Director of Quality or Utilization Management)
- Review and analyze portfolio performance payer accounts
- Ability to engage infusion partners in performance related conversations, ensuring performance metrics and continuous improvement processes are in place
- Exercise sound judgment and oversight to ensure integrity and compliance with argenx Cultural Pillars
- Deep understanding of US healthcare market, policy, and reimbursement
- Strategic thinking with strong execution capabilities
- Possess a compliance mindset- with an ability to adhere to defined and appropriate argenx compliance guidelines, policies and procedures
- Experience in rare disease, oncology, immunology, or specialty biologics
- High ethical standards
- Ability to translate complex policy into commercial impact
- Strong communication and stakeholder leadership skills
- Minimum of 10 years of experience in the pharmaceutical/biotech industry, Orphan and rare disease experience required
- Minimum 4 years of experience in primary management of targeted payer accounts
- Recent launch experience in Medical and Pharmacy benefit products required
- Knowledge of Buy and Bill, Medicaid, Medicare B/D, and reimbursement programs required
- Established and well documented key contacts with assigned Regional payers is required
- Excellent oral and written communication skills
- Experience operating in a cross functional, matrix environment
- Extensive Travel required
